Muscat Thread Mills SAOG (MSM: MTMI)
Oman flag Oman · Delayed Price · Currency is OMR
0.140
0.00 (0.00%)
At close: Dec 24, 2024

Muscat Thread Mills SAOG Ratios and Metrics

Millions OMR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
211111
Upgrade
Market Cap Growth
129.97%9.09%-25.93%4.17%-8.86%0%
Upgrade
Enterprise Value
211112
Upgrade
Last Close Price
0.140.050.050.070.060.06
Upgrade
PE Ratio
5.528.0565.6215.82-11.09
Upgrade
PS Ratio
0.540.290.240.320.410.35
Upgrade
PB Ratio
1.040.490.480.640.640.65
Upgrade
P/TBV Ratio
0.920.490.480.640.640.65
Upgrade
P/FCF Ratio
12.853.543.35-3.34-
Upgrade
P/OCF Ratio
5.272.993.19-3.17-
Upgrade
EV/Sales Ratio
0.600.350.370.380.490.42
Upgrade
EV/EBITDA Ratio
4.204.019.976.7812.385.41
Upgrade
EV/EBIT Ratio
4.795.0218.7810.61292.038.52
Upgrade
EV/FCF Ratio
13.744.245.10-4.01-
Upgrade
Debt / Equity Ratio
0.140.210.270.310.260.24
Upgrade
Debt / EBITDA Ratio
0.531.343.352.633.761.58
Upgrade
Debt / FCF Ratio
1.741.471.85-1.35-
Upgrade
Asset Turnover
1.301.081.151.190.971.37
Upgrade
Inventory Turnover
2.622.042.302.492.363.68
Upgrade
Quick Ratio
1.071.141.050.871.201.33
Upgrade
Current Ratio
2.652.652.622.072.422.85
Upgrade
Return on Equity (ROE)
19.63%6.33%0.73%4.14%-2.05%6.01%
Upgrade
Return on Assets (ROA)
10.10%4.73%1.42%2.67%0.10%4.22%
Upgrade
Return on Capital (ROIC)
13.57%6.15%1.88%3.55%0.13%5.03%
Upgrade
Earnings Yield
18.11%12.42%1.52%6.32%-3.33%9.01%
Upgrade
FCF Yield
7.78%28.26%29.86%-9.09%29.92%-9.56%
Upgrade
Dividend Yield
3.50%8.97%-4.15%-11.76%
Upgrade
Payout Ratio
20.06%-324.84%---
Upgrade
Buyback Yield / Dilution
12.49%-0.18%-0.18%--0.86%
Upgrade
Total Shareholder Return
15.99%8.79%-4.33%-10.90%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.